## Deployment

Shipping ScanBridge to prod is mostly painless these days. Build the container, push it to the Kestrelhaven registry, and let the deploy job roll it out across the warehouse gateways. The tricky part is the scanner firmware handshake — if the Voxline readers are on firmware older than 4.2, the integration falls back to legacy mode and throughput tanks, so check that first. Once the pods are healthy, verify the dispatcher picks up the following settings.

settings of yageg-yahap:
[gorael]
team = olieth
access_code = ac_941d74
owner = brieth.aldiel
host = gorael.tolvaqio.internal
port = 6379
peer = briwyn.urlaqtech.internal
salt = 116e6622
pin = 1957

Plugins must not import Fernwheel
# session objects directly anymore; route everything through the shim's
# connection broker, which handles pooling, statement caching, and the
# lazy-load cutover flags. Behavior should be identical for well-behaved
# plugins, but edge cases around detached instances will now raise
# instead of silently reattaching. If your plugin needs different limits,
# override via your manifest rather than patching. The shim's default
# tuning constants are defined immediately below.

tuning table, hafog-bahaf:
QUOTAS = {
    "praion": 144,
    "briax": 906,
    "silwyn": 451,
}

## Tuning

Squintle flags candidate packages by edit distance against the Hollowmark registry's top downloads, then scores them on publish age and maintainer overlap. Raising the distance threshold catches more squats but floods the review queue; lower it for quieter alerts. Defaults were calibrated on six months of Hollowmark data. The current constants are shown below.

tuning constants:
QUOTAS = {
    "druwyn": 5,
    "holix": 5,
    "zorath": 5,
    "holwyn": 10,
}

Quarterly Planning Note — Logistics

Board summary: we are exiting the Halbrook Carriers contract at renewal and moving to Tervane Logistics. Savings projected at 11% annually; service levels contractually equal or better. Transition window is eight weeks, overlapping carriers for two. Operations owns execution; finance tracks exit fees. No customer impact expected. One sensitive point accompanies this note for board eyes only.

management briefing: Project Ulavan slips by two quarters because of the staffing delay.